    2011 328i xDrive sedan, manual transmission, 117,000 miles. I need to replace the rear shocks. Shocks are different for "Sport" package vs non sport. I have not been able to determine if the car has the sports package as none of the VIN decoders I've tried provide this info. Additionally, the VIN decoders each give some wrong info. One recommended in one of these forum posts (bimmer.work) identifies the car as having an automatic transmission. Another VIN decoder indicates the car is a turbo (it is not). So, how do I determine if I have the sports package or not before I purchase rear shocks? Incidentally, the VIN decoder at www.bmwvin.com seems to be the most accurate.
